Individual stats:

Starters:
Mitchell 31-2-9 with 2 steals in 34 minutes. 12-21 FG Great start to his Cavs career! He carried us.
Mobley 14-6-1 with a steal and a block in 35 minutes. Only 10 shots. Hmmm. I'd like at least 15
Allen 13-10-0 with 2 blocks in 34 minutes Only 8 shots. I want him to get 15 too.
LeVert 10-5-7 in 34 minutes Only 2-7 FG
Garland 4-1-3 with 2 steals and a block in 13 minutes He didn't get a chance to get going.

Bench: 31-14-7 in 28 minutes. We outscored Toronto.
Okoro 0-0-0- in 12 minutes. Oops. Try again
Love 8-7-2 in 21 minutes. Only 1-4 from 3. If he makes 2 more, we win.
Wade 8-3-2 with a block in 22 minutes
Osman 17-3-1 in 28 minutes. A good Cedi game.
Neto 0-1-0 in 6 minutes. Not a good look, but he did better than Okoro.
